Chippewa Falls, Wisconsin, presents an appealing environment for seniors in independent living communities, thanks to its blend of scenic beauty and community-focused amenities. The Chippewa Falls Senior Center offers a variety of programs tailored for older adults, including fitness classes and social events that foster connection among residents. Additionally, the city features picturesque parks like Irvine Park, where seniors can enjoy leisurely walks or picnics amidst beautiful natural surroundings. Access to healthcare facilities, such as the HSHS St. Joseph’s Hospital, ensures that medical support is readily available. With its welcoming atmosphere and numerous senior-friendly services, Chippewa Falls is an ideal location for independent living.

Considerations for seniors living in Chippewa Falls, WI
Affordable cost of living: Compared to other cities in the United States, Chippewa Falls has a relatively low cost of living which can be especially beneficial for seniors who are on fixed incomes.
Access to healthcare: The city has several medical facilities and hospitals that offer high-quality care for seniors.
Recreational opportunities: Chippewa Falls is known for its beautiful parks and scenic riverfront which offer opportunities for outdoor recreation such as fishing, kayaking and hiking.
Cultural activities: The senior center in the city provides various cultural activities including art classes, music programs and organized trips to museums.
Community involvement: The city has a strong sense of community with residents who are friendly and welcoming which can help seniors feel connected and engaged.
Accessible transportation: Options like public transportation and ride-sharing services make it easy for seniors to get around the city even if they don't drive themselves.
Safe environment: Chippewa Falls is a relatively safe place to live, which can offer peace of mind for seniors who may feel vulnerable or anxious about their safety in other areas.
